boren - 飞机大战9之战机爆炸

import pygame
import sys
import random # 产生随机数
import feiji
import diji

# 控制飞机
def key_kong(hero):
    for shi_jian in pygame.event.get():
        # type 类型   QUIT 退出
        if shi_jian.type == pygame.QUIT:
            pygame.quit()  # 退出游戏
            sys.exit()  # 系统文件的退出
        # 判断是否按了键 KEY
        elif shi_jian.type == pygame.KEYDOWN:
            # 检测电脑是否按了a键,向左移动
            if shi_jian.key == pygame.K_a :
                hero.move_left()
            elif shi_jian.key == pygame.K_d :
                hero.move_right()
            elif shi_jian.key == pygame.K_j:
                hero.fashe()
            elif shi_jian.key == pygame.K_b:
                hero.zhanji_boom()


# 1。初始化
def zhu():
    pygame.init()
    # 2。设置一个窗口
    chuangkou = pygame.display.set_mode((400, 700))
    # 3。设置一个标题
    pygame.display.set_caption("飞机大战")
    # 6. 导入图片 image图像   load 加载
    bei_jing = pygame.image.load("图片/background.png")
    # 创建一个飞机对象
    feiji1 = feiji.feiji(chuangkou)
    diji_ku = [] # 列表
    pygame.key.set_repeat(1,1)
    # 5。循环
    while True:
        # 把背景放上去
        chuangkou.blit(bei_jing, (0, 0))
        # 把飞机和相关元素放上窗口去
        feiji1.show()
        b = random.randint(1,300)
        if b == 5:
            diji_ku.append(diji.diji(chuangkou))

        for diji1 in diji_ku:
            diji1.show()
            diji1.move()
            diji1.fashe()
            if diji1.yuejie():
                # remove是通过内容把列表中的元素删除
                diji_ku.remove(diji1)

        # 爆炸判断?
        for diji2 in diji_ku:
            if diji2.x<feiji1.x+100 and diji2.x+51>feiji1.x:
                if diji2.y<feiji1.y+124 and diji2.y+39>feiji1.y:
                    feiji1.zhanji_boom()

        # 控制飞机jj
        key_kong(feiji1)
        print("---")
        # key_kong2(diji1 , 2)
        # 4.刷新
        pygame.display.update()


# main主要的函数
if __name__ == '__main__':
    zhu()



import pygame
import zidan
import random
"""
敌机类:
属性:飞机位置 ,飞机图片,飞机名字,飞机窗口
方法:移动,开火
"""
class diji():
    def __init__(self,ck):
        self.name="diji"
        self.x = random.randint(0,400)
        self.y = 0
        self.picture = pygame.image.load("图片/enemy-1.gif")
        self.zidan_ku=[]
        self.chuangkou = ck
        self.fang_xiang = "right"
    def show(self):
        self.chuangkou.blit(self.picture,(self.x,self.y))
        for dan_ge_zidan in self.zidan_ku:
            dan_ge_zidan.show()
            # 飞机的子弹移动
            dan_ge_zidan.move__djfd()
            if dan_ge_zidan.yuejie2():
                self.zidan_ku.remove(dan_ge_zidan)

    def move(self):
        self.y += 1
        # self.x += 1

    def fashe(self):
        a = random.randint(1,100)
        if a==2:
            self.zidan_ku.append(zidan.zidan(self.chuangkou, self.x + 0, self.y +0, "图片/bullet.png"))

    def yuejie(self):
        if self.y > 700:
            return True
        else:
            return False




import pygame
import zidan
import time
import sys

class feiji():
    def __init__(self, ck):
        self.name = "hero"
        self.x = 200
        self.y = 400
        self.chuangkou = ck
        self.picture = pygame.image.load("图片/hero1.png")
        self.zidan_ku = []
        # 爆炸代码
        self.boom = False  # 判断战机是否被撞击
        self.boom_picture = []  # 爆炸图库
        self.jiaru_boom_picture()  # 爆炸图库加入图片的函数
        self.boom_picture_num = 0  # 第几张爆炸图片
        self.image_index = 0 # 计数,当达到一定数值显示下一张图片

    def jiaru_boom_picture(self):
        self.boom_picture.append(pygame.image.load("图片/hero_blowup_n1.png"))
        self.boom_picture.append(pygame.image.load("图片/hero_blowup_n2.png"))
        self.boom_picture.append(pygame.image.load("图片/hero_blowup_n3.png"))
        self.boom_picture.append(pygame.image.load("图片/hero_blowup_n4.png"))

    # 把飞机放到屏幕上
    def show(self):
        if self.boom == True:
            self.chuangkou.blit(self.boom_picture[self.boom_picture_num], (self.x, self.y))
            self.image_index += 1
            if self.image_index == 70:
                self.image_index = 0
                self.boom_picture_num += 1


            if self.boom_picture_num > 3:
                time.sleep(2)
                pygame.quit()  # 退出游戏
                sys.exit()  # 系统文件的退出
        else:
            self.chuangkou.blit(self.picture, (self.x, self.y))

        # 如果有子弹,就放上窗口
        # print(len(self.zidan_ku))
        for dan_ge_zidan in self.zidan_ku:
            dan_ge_zidan.show()
            # 飞机的子弹移动
            dan_ge_zidan.move__fd()
            if dan_ge_zidan.yuejie():
                self.zidan_ku.remove(dan_ge_zidan)

    # move 向左移动
    def move_left(self):
        self.x -= 20
        if self.x < -25:
            self.x = 5

    # 向右移动
    def move_right(self):
        self.x += 20
        if self.x >= 330:
            self.x = 330

    # 发射子弹的函数
    def fashe(self):
        # 新建子弹对象保存到zidan1变量到列表里去
        self.zidan_ku.append(zidan.zidan(self.chuangkou, self.x + 48, self.y - 10, "图片/bullet.png"))
        self.zidan_ku.append(zidan.zidan(self.chuangkou, self.x + 14, self.y + 25, "图片/bullet1.png"))
        self.zidan_ku.append(zidan.zidan(self.chuangkou, self.x + 80, self.y + 25, "图片/bullet2.png"))

    def zhanji_boom(self):
        self.boom = True

import pygame
# 子弹的类
# 属性:子弹的位置 ,子弹窗口,子弹图片,伤害,子弹名字,子弹数量,
# 方法:子弹的show展示,move移动
class zidan():
    def __init__(self, ck, x, y, zidan_tupian):
        self.x = x
        self.y = y
        self.window = ck
        self.picture = pygame.image.load(zidan_tupian)

    def show(self):
        # print("子弹的y坐标是%d"%self.y)
        self.window.blit(self.picture, (self.x, self.y))

    def move__fd(self):
        self.y = self.y - 1
    def move__djfd(self):
        self.y = self.y + 2

    def yuejie(self):
        if self.y < -100:
            return True
        else:
            return False

    def yuejie2(self):
        if self.y > 700:
            return True
        else:
            return False
